Output 6ff6630b1839f3e3fabae33cfa4dfdb47c433e704706a6e9060f39ef19261b64:2

value
23495872
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 57c908f990d16425fa211131ff1ac5cf352e7198 OP_EQUALVERIFY OP_CHECKSIG
address
191AcrJGJjAqygVVmfURcM98ZECkkLC4eq
transaction
6ff6630b1839f3e3fabae33cfa4dfdb47c433e704706a6e9060f39ef19261b64
spent
true